No Man's Ridge


A helicopter soars over the forests in the remote Wyoming wilderness of No Man’s Ridge area. Inside are five heavily armed and formidable hunters all dressed in militarized camouflage fatigues and face paint. They have state-of-the-art high-powered rifles, heavy caliber handguns, crossbows and hunting gear. The extreme hunters are there to bag a Bigfoot— the ultimate hunt for the ultimate trophy. The hunters wear hat cams with compact high-resolution HD cameras to record the hunt. They also have gun cams for their rifle barrels, bow cams and portable trail cameras to put on trees. In the far reaches of the wilds, the people are dropped from the hovering chopper by cable into deep forest, fifty miles from civilization. When the five hunters see an actual giant Bigfoot walking through the woods a half-mile away, it seems like the creature doesn’t have a chance—but it’s the other way around.

PROJECT DETAILS:

With pre-production mostly done and financing set, filming was reportedly aimed to begin sometime in 2020 in Wyoming, but then Covid hit, which obviously halted production. It's currently not known what the status of the project is, but it will likely move forward again at some point. (10/3/23)

Practical FX legend Robert Kurtzman (Evil Dead 2, From Dusk Till Dawn, The Faculty, House on Haunted Hill) is handling the creature effects in the movie.

Co-written and directed by Eric Red (100 Feet, Bad Moon, Near Dark, The Hitcher).

This project has been in and out of development for over a decade, with filming originally set to begin in the Summer of 2014 in Wyoming.
